libpng16.so.16 não encontrado - como obtê-lo?

3

Eu recentemente tentei instalar o mupen64plus na minha máquina Lubuntu. Depois de fazer este comando:

sudo apt-get install mupen64plus

a instalação continua sem erro e tudo configura ok. Mas depois de executar o programa, recebo uma mensagem de erro sobre libpng16.so.16 não estar presente no sistema. Depois de fazer uma pesquisa completa do sistema de arquivos, não consegui encontrar a biblioteca compartilhada em qualquer lugar . Então, existe um pacote ou repositório de código-fonte onde eu possa instalar esse arquivo de biblioteca compartilhada MIA em / usr / share / lib? Depois de fazer várias pesquisas no Google, não consegui encontrar nada para o efeito. Tanto quanto eu posso dizer, ninguém teve esse problema, ou tão poucos tiveram que o Google não pode encontrar nada sobre isso.

    
por nkeck72 22.11.2015 / 21:18

3 respostas

3

Encontrei a resposta para essa questão, há um repositório de fontes no Sourceforge: link O truque quando você instala o objeto compartilhado é quando você o instala, você tem que executar

ldconfig

antes que o sistema o veja.

    
por nkeck72 22.11.2015 / 21:30
3

Tente instalar o libpng-libary Versão 16:

sudo apt-get install libpng16-16
    
por JoKalliauer 13.03.2018 / 10:40
0

Você pode baixar a biblioteca manualmente a partir do link link

Ele baixará um arquivo como "libpng-1.6.32.tar.xz"

Basta extrair o arquivo e encontrar um arquivo INSTALL para instruções sobre como instalar a biblioteca.

./configure
make check
make install

Então você precisa executar

ldconfig

Espero que isso funcione!

    
por Krishan Kumar Mourya 06.10.2017 / 23:04